In South Carolina, a couple is either married or not married. Separation in South Carolina simply means that you and your spouse no longer live together. There is no legal status between being married and divorced, although there may be court orders put in place during the time of separation.
SC does not require a legal separation before you can get your final divorce decree, although you may be required to live separate and apart for one year if it is a no-fault divorce. An Order for Separate Maintenance and Support is not required for you to get your divorce.
South Carolina requires couples to live separately for one year before divorcing in order to obtain a no-fault divorce. If you and your spouse break that separation period, a judge may have grounds to deny your divorce.

Can I Date While I Am Separated in South Carolina? There is no law that specifically states that you may not date another person while you are separated.
South Carolina does not recognize legal separation.
